Output 66852dff639a6105f0c66eb73c053649375dd0f0ec70d955e4e215264b005022:31

value
368554
script pubkey
OP_0 OP_PUSHBYTES_20 4be765f8357a847c70b2eb4732fae5e91811de32
address
bc1qf0nkt7p402z8cu9jadrn97h9ayvprh3jsn5nvx
transaction
66852dff639a6105f0c66eb73c053649375dd0f0ec70d955e4e215264b005022